: Let L be the operator on P3 defined by L(p(x)) = xp'(x) + p''(x). If p(x) = a0 + a1 + a2(1+x^2), calculate L^n(p(x)).

OpenStudy (anonymous):

More info/answers to earlier parts of question: Matrix representation A with respect to the standard basis for polynomials = \[\left[\begin{matrix}0 & 0 & 2 \\ 0 & 1 & 0 \\ 0 & 0 & 2\end{matrix}\right]\] Matrix representation B with respect to [1,x,1+x^2] = \[\left[\begin{matrix}0 & 0 & 0 \\ 0 & 1 & 0 \\ 0 & 0 & 2\end{matrix}\right]\] Transition matrix from [1,x,1+x^2] to standard = \[\left[\begin{matrix}1 & 0 & 1 \\ 0 & 1 & 0 \\ 0 & 0 & 1\end{matrix}\right]\]
